# Build Provenance — Sketchline Undo/Redo

Undo and redo in the Sketchline diagram editor are handled by the history-stack module, rebuilt in this cycle. Each command now serializes its inverse at commit time; redo replays from the serialized log rather than a memory snapshot. This removes the crash on redo-after-autosave. Provenance: built on the Tallgrass runner from the locked manifest, reproducible byte-for-byte across two runs. No vendored deps changed. Releases must cite the token recorded below.

build token for kagaf-hahof: htk14_9d3d4d26d7d8de

Looks fine overall. One note for support: the Ledgerlens viewer now paginates server-side, so the old "export everything" trick won't work past the row cap — use the date-range filter instead. Timeouts and page sizes are configurable per deployment, but changing them requires a restart. If a customer hits limits, compare their config against the shipped defaults, which are:

tuning constants:
RATE_LIMITS = {
    "goriel": 284,
    "brieth": 236,
    "lamvan": 916,
    "druok": 255,
    "wenion": 979,
    "istmir": 343,
    "queniel": 302,
}

**Ticket: Notification fan-out backpressure stalls under burst load**

Fan-out workers in Pellwick queue unbounded when the push gateway slows; memory climbs until the pod is killed. Fix adds a bounded channel with drop-oldest policy and a saturation metric. Reviewer: check the shutdown path — draining must not block. Load test passed at 5x normal burst. Token for the tested build is below.

pipeline stamp: htk3_cc5

Internal Memo — Legacy Pricing Change

For the incoming director. Effective next quarter, legacy customers on the Hallett platform move to current list pricing, phased over two billing cycles. Expect pushback from the Orvington accounts; retention offers are pre-approved up to 10%. Comms drafts are with the Velsten team. Do not discuss externally until the announcement date. The following note is strictly confidential.

management briefing: Project Ulavan slips by two quarters because of the staffing delay.